Output 78c58a971b94839141284d4f3b5adc11322174efb14f899976ef85b5e7e53d59:70

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2c2574d4823ed3271dcffa134efbe2c60fd22f OP_EQUAL
address
38j4qeuXdQxWFXvLin5pGaEzgeJMMDPm4P
transaction
78c58a971b94839141284d4f3b5adc11322174efb14f899976ef85b5e7e53d59
spent
true